Road to Vostok — VR Mod v1.1.4
A VR mod for Road to Vostok (Early Access). Play the full game in
virtual reality with full head tracking, motion controllers, and physical weapon handling.
Requirements
- Road to Vostok installed via Steam
- A PC VR headset supported by OpenXR (Meta Quest via Link/AirLink, Valve Index, HTC Vive, WMR, etc.)

Holster System
Weapons are drawn and holstered by reaching to body locations and gripping.
Your controller will buzz when your hand enters a holster zone.
| Location | Weapon Slot |
|---|---|
| Right shoulder | Primary weapon |
| Right hip | Sidearm |
| Left hip | Knife |
| Chest | Grenades |
Whichever hand draws the weapon becomes the weapon hand — the other hand is the support hand.
| Action | Result |
|---|---|
| Grip near a holster zone | Draw weapon into that hand |
| Release grip (slot 1, away from body) | Sling — weapon hangs at chest height, follows player yaw |
| Release grip (slots 2–4, away from body) | Auto-holster immediately |
| Release grip near own holster zone | Holster completely |
| Grip near a different holster zone | Swap weapon |
If a slot has no weapon equipped, releasing the grip immediately holsters with no effect.
Sling (Primary Weapon Only)
Releasing the grip on your primary weapon (slot 1) away from a holster zone puts it in
sling position — the weapon hangs at chest height in front of you and follows your yaw
as you turn, just like a rifle on a real sling.
To raise the weapon from sling: grip with either hand (dominant or off-hand).
To holster from sling: grip near your right-shoulder holster zone.
Slots 2, 3, and 4 (sidearm, knife, grenade) auto-holster when you release the grip.

Grenades
Grenades (slot 4, chest holster) use a two-step mechanic:
| Input | Action |
|---|---|
| Weapon hand trigger (pin not pulled) | Pull pin — controller buzzes, grenade is armed |
| Weapon hand grip release (pin pulled) | Throw — grenade flies in controller aim direction |
| Weapon hand trigger (pin pulled) | Replace pin — disarms grenade, cancels throw |
The grenade is automatically holstered 0.5 s after throwing. Aim with your controller —
the throw direction follows wherever the weapon hand is pointing at the moment you release
the grip. The controller buzzes continuously while the pin is pulled.
Bolt-action Rifles & Pump-action Shotguns
These weapons require manually cycling the action between shots. B opens and closes
the loading port instead of changing fire mode.
Loading:
- Press B to open the action
- Press support hand trigger (without gripping for two-hand aim) to load one round or shell — repeat until full
- Press B again to close the action
Cycling between shots:
| Weapon type | Action |
|---|---|
| Bolt-action | Lower the weapon (release grip away from body), then press dominant trigger — the bolt cycles and the weapon automatically raises back |
| Pump-action shotgun | Grab with the support hand grip, then make a quick pump motion (push forward, pull back) — one shell is chambered per pump |
Scope Zoom
On variable-zoom scopes, push right stick up to zoom in and right stick down to
zoom out while the weapon is drawn. A haptic pulse confirms each step.

Wrist Watch HUD
During gameplay your health, status effects, and other HUD info are displayed on a
wrist-mounted watch on your non-dominant hand. Raise your wrist toward your face to
reveal it — the display fades in when you look at it and fades out when you look away.
All watch settings (glance angle, fade speed, size, position on wrist) are tunable in the
F8 config screen under Wrist Watch. You can also disable glance-to-reveal so the watch
is always visible.

Foregrip Adjust Mode
Calibrate exactly where the support hand visually grips the weapon during two-hand aiming.
The weapon model is frozen in place so you can position your hand precisely.
Requires Gun Config to be On — enable it in the F8 config screen under Controls.
- Draw a weapon and grab with the off-hand (support grip)
- Press X (left) while the off-hand is gripping → the gun freezes in place
- Physically move your support hand to the foregrip position on the frozen weapon
- Press A (right) to save the current hand position as the foregrip point
- Press X (left) to discard and exit without saving
The mode also exits automatically if you release the off-hand grip.
Once saved, the support hand visual will lock to that exact point on the weapon every time
you use a two-hand grip — regardless of where your controller physically is.

Troubleshooting
Black screen in headset after launch
Make sure SteamVR or the Meta PC app is running before you start the game.
The Main Menu launches VR into a black screen, but a VR camera is not started until the world actually loads in.
Mod behaves like an older version / changes have no effect
A stale vr_mod_init.gd in the game root (Road to Vostok\vr_mod_init.gd) overrides the
script inside the VMZ. Delete that file — Metro loads the correct version from mods\vr-mod.vmz.
Weapon floats at wrong position
Enable Gun Config in F8 → Controls, then use Grip Adjust Mode (X while weapon drawn) to tune the grip offset live.
If the issue persists across sessions, check vr_mod_debug.log in %APPDATA%\Road to Vostok\vr_mod\.
Can't click buttons in menu screens
Click on buttons with 'A' button instead of trigger.
